What Type of Medicine is Verrucid? (Identity and Classification)

Verrucid is a targeted topical dermatological agent defined by its single active substance, Salicylic Acid (INN), making it a monopreparation. It is categorized as a potent keratolytic agent, placing it within the high-level Salicylate pharmacological group. This product is based on a synthetic compound.

Its function is clinically recognized for its specific ability to disrupt excessive keratin buildup, which is supported by pharmacological studies. The specific formulation of Verrucid is typically intended for use by adults and adolescents, and it is positioned for concentrated, localized treatment where precision is required. The specific classification of Salicylic Acid falls under local dermatological preparations, confirming its regional action on the skin.

Verrucid's Primary Composition and General Purpose

The core component is Salicylic Acid, which is consistently formulated as a concentrated, high-strength liquid solution delivered via the topical route. This solution typically utilizes a specialized base containing organic solvents, such as an alcoholic component, along with excipients like collodion, which function to create a film that ensures the active ingredient adheres to and penetrates the small, affected area.

The overall therapeutic purpose of this preparation is to facilitate the progressive and targeted dissolution and subsequent shedding (desquamation) of undesirable, hardened skin tissue. This keratolytic action provides a mechanism to assist the body in gradually removing areas affected by hyperkeratosis, which is the medical term for abnormal skin thickening. Topical Salicylic Acid is used to help peel skin, promoting the removal of the outer layer of skin and supporting the restoration of normal skin texture.

What side effects are possible with Verrucid?

Possible Side Effects and Safety Information

The safety profile for topical Salicylic Acid (Verrucid) is primarily defined by localized application site reactions and the documented potential for systemic toxicity, as classified in regulatory documents.


Adverse Reaction Scope

The most commonly classified effects are local and fall under Skin and Subcutaneous Tissue Disorders.

Classification Reported Adverse Reaction (Examples)
Common Local irritation, burning sensation, peeling, dryness, and pruritus (itching) at the application site.
Incidence Not Known Allergic reactions, color changes, severe local tissue damage (ulceration).

Serious Adverse Reactions and Systemic Risk

While rare with correct topical use, the official safety profile documents the risk of systemic absorption, potentially leading to Salicylate Toxicity (Salicylism). Symptoms of salicylism, which affect the Nervous System Disorders class, may include persistent tinnitus (ringing in the ears), dizziness, severe nausea, or confusion. Severe local tissue damage, such as ulceration, is a risk associated with excessive or improper use.


Population-Specific Constraints and Limitations

Official labeling defines constraints to mitigate risk, particularly regarding systemic absorption. The solution is contraindicated in patients with diabetes or impaired peripheral blood circulation due to the heightened risk of severe local skin complications and delayed healing. Additionally, use in the pediatric population is constrained, especially when viral illnesses like the flu or chickenpox are present, due to the risk of Reye's syndrome.

The product must not be applied to large areas of the body, broken, red, inflamed, or infected skin, or to the face, to limit the potential for adverse local and systemic effects.

Overdose and Emergency Response

Overdose and When to Seek Help

This section describes the officially documented information regarding Verrucid overdose, strictly following regulatory standards found in government-authorized prescribing information.

Documented Overdose Manifestations

Official reports indicate that excessive ingestion of Verrucid may lead to severe gastrointestinal distress, including pronounced nausea and vomiting. Central nervous system involvement is frequently documented, presenting as somnolence (drowsiness) and ataxia (loss of muscle coordination). In severe cases, potential cardiotoxicity has been noted through changes in vital signs or electrocardiogram (ECG) findings.

Mandatory Emergency Actions

Immediate medical attention is required for any known or suspected overdose. The official regulatory stance emphasizes that emergency medical services must be contacted immediately if the individual is unresponsive, experiences seizure activity, has significant difficulty breathing, or shows signs of cardiovascular instability, such as a severe drop in blood pressure or a rapid, irregular heartbeat.

Official Management Strategy

Management of Verrucid overdose is generally symptomatic and supportive. As a specific antidote may not be officially listed, treatment focuses on maintaining vital functions and correcting fluid or electrolyte imbalances. Supportive measures often include continuous observation, monitoring of cardiac function, and, if appropriate for the type of drug, gastric decontamination procedures.

Eligibility and Restrictions for Use

Who Can and Cannot Use Verrucid?

The official eligibility profile for Verrucid (Salicylic Acid Topical Solution) is strictly defined by regulatory documentation concerning age, health conditions, and application site.

Contraindicated Populations (Must Not Use):

Population/Condition Restriction Basis
Diabetes or Poor Circulation High risk of ulceration and delayed healing.
Hypersensitivity Known allergy to Salicylic Acid or formulation components.
Children/Teenagers Contraindicated if recovering from flu or chickenpox (Reye's syndrome risk).

Age and Physiological Restrictions:

  • Use is not recommended for children under 2 years of age, as safety is not established.
  • Application is prohibited on broken, irritated, inflamed, or infected skin and on sensitive areas like the face or genitals.
  • In pregnancy, use is restricted and generally limited to short-term application on a small area.
  • Use is permissible during breastfeeding, but the solution must be kept away from the chest area.

What should I know about interactions with other medicines?

Verrucid is a topical solution containing salicylic acid, which is intended for external use only. Since systemic absorption through the skin is generally low when used as directed on small, localized areas, the risk of interactions with systemically administered (oral or injectable) medicines is considered minimal.

However, caution is required when Verrucid is used concomitantly with other topical preparations on the same treatment area. The keratolytic (peeling) and penetrating properties of salicylic acid may increase the absorption of other medicated creams, ointments, or solutions applied to the same area, potentially leading to increased side effects from the co-administered topical medicine.


Topical Preparations to Avoid

To prevent excessive skin irritation, dryness, or increased systemic absorption, avoid using other topical treatments on the wart or callus being treated with Verrucid, unless specifically advised by a healthcare professional. These include:

  • Other peeling agents (e.g., benzoyl peroxide, resorcinol, sulfur, retinoids, or other salicylic acid-containing products).
  • Abrasive soaps, cleansers, or alcohol-containing preparations.
  • Other topical medicines for the skin.

If severe local irritation develops, discontinue use of Verrucid. Always inform your doctor or pharmacist about all other topical and systemic medicines, supplements, or herbal products you are currently using.

Mechanism of Action

Verrucid utilizes salicylic acid as its principal pharmacologically active agent, exhibiting a keratolytic mechanism of action. The drug is applied topically to regions of hyperkeratinization. Once applied, salicylic acid penetrates the stratum corneum and acts by disrupting the structural integrity of the corneocytes. Its primary biological target involves the dissolution of the intercellular cement, specifically the corneodesmosomes, which anchor the keratinized cells together. This targeted dissolution is mediated by increasing the hydration and subsequent swelling of the cornified tissue and modulating the pH within the applied tissue layer. The alteration of cell adhesion facilitates the detachment and shedding of the hyperkeratotic epithelial layer. This cascade results in a system-level physiological consequence of controlled desquamation of the abnormal, thickened skin architecture.

Dosage and Administration Information

How to Use Verrucid

Verrucid, a high-strength liquid solution containing Salicylic Acid, is administered via the topical route and is intended only for localized application to hyperkeratotic lesions. Official usage instructions focus on a precise regimen and specific preparation steps to ensure correct administration.


Official Administration Guidelines

The established protocol details the frequency, dosing unit, and conditions for use:

Feature Guideline
Route of Administration Topical (Dermatological Use Only)
Dosing Schedule Application of a small amount (e.g., one drop or thin layer) sufficient to cover the lesion
Frequency Once or twice daily

Procedural Context and Duration

Prior to each dose, the affected area is typically instructed to be soaked in warm water for several minutes and then dried completely. Subsequent application often requires the user to gently remove loose, dead tissue from the lesion surface before the solution is applied. This solution must be applied only to the targeted area, strictly avoiding surrounding healthy skin. Due to its formulation, the solution is flammable and must be kept away from heat or flame.

Treatment is intended to continue until the lesion is entirely removed, but official guidelines often specify a maximum duration of 12 weeks if the lesion persists. For pediatric use, the solution is authorized for individuals 2 years of age and older, with adult supervision mandated for children under 12. Patients with circulatory problems or certain chronic health conditions are instructed to use the product only under medical supervision.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Verrucid

Evidence for Use in Common and Plantar Warts

Research has extensively explored the use of Verrucid, which contains Salicylic Acid, for conditions associated with abnormal skin thickening, particularly common warts and plantar warts. The evidence base for this use includes Randomized Controlled Trials (RCTs) and Systematic Reviews that combine data from multiple trials. These studies were designed to measure outcomes such as the complete clearance or disappearance of the wart lesion and the time required for that clearance across different study groups. The studies monitored responses over defined time intervals.

The primary outcome measured in the literature was complete lesion clearance at defined follow-up points. Studies report how symptoms evolved in the observed populations, and findings describe patterns observed when the acid solution was compared against a control (placebo) solution. The results observed were not uniform, and research describes the wide variation in trial design, such as the specific concentration of the acid used or the application regimen, as a contributing factor.

Evidence for Use in Corns and Calluses

Clinical evaluation for Verrucid's use in corns and calluses was evaluated in various clinical trials and application studies. Research examined the condition, which is marked by functional limitations and involves periods of heightened symptoms related to pressure on the affected area. The studies explored two main outcomes: the objective assessment of tissue removal from the hardened skin and outcomes related to physical discomfort.

Studies monitored responses over defined time intervals, and findings describe patterns observed related to the objective removal of excess tissue. These trials also tracked changes in discomfort levels over the period of observation. Data are still emerging for this indication; existing studies are generally smaller in sample size, and the number of large, high-quality Randomized Controlled Trials focusing specifically on corns and calluses is low.

Long-Term Research and Durability of Outcomes

Available research typically features limited follow-up durations, with outcomes often reported at three to six months after the study began. Research provides insight into short-term changes observed during the study period. The certainty remains low regarding the long-term stability of the changes observed in preventing the return of these lesions.

Q: How exactly does Salicylic Acid work to remove a wart?

Verrucid's active ingredient, Salicylic Acid, is classified as a keratolytic agent. According to health information sources, this means it works by softening and loosening the thick, scaly, or hardened outer layer of skin. This process helps the abnormal skin tissue to shed or be detached.


Q: What are the differences between common warts and plantar warts?

Official health resources indicate that the location of the wart is the main difference. Common warts often appear on the hands and fingers, while plantar warts develop on the soles of the feet. Plantar warts can sometimes grow inward due to the pressure of walking, which may cause discomfort.

How should Verrucid be stored and disposed of?

How to Store and Dispose of Verrucid?

Verrucid (Salicylic Acid topical solution) must be stored according to official regulatory requirements, primarily due to its volatile nature and potential toxicity if ingested.

Storage Requirements

Condition Requirement
Temperature Store at controlled room temperature (20 C to 25 C) and protect from freezing or excessive heat.
Handling The solution is flammable; keep the product away from fire or flame and do not store near heat sources.
Container Keep the container tightly closed when not in use, and store it in its original packaging.
Stability Do not use the solution if crystals have formed, as this indicates product degradation.

Disposal and Safety

Keep all medication out of the sight and reach of children and pets, preferably in a locked location. For disposal, unused or expired Verrucid should not be poured down any drain or sewer. Instead, use a community drug take-back program or dispose of the item in household trash after mixing it with an undesirable substance, following official environmental guidance.
